家底 (jiā) — family financial reserves or assets; family wealth or patrimony

Definition

Literally 'family bottom,' 家底 refers to the total financial assets or savings a family has built up — the underlying wealth, not income. Compare 厚 (thick, large reserves) vs 薄 (thin, meager) — these are the standard collocations.
